Product details

It is a current-production part. The S3 frame (146 mm high, 70 mm wide, 139 mm deep) occupies a standard DIN-rail footprint with room for auxiliary contact blocks on the front.

Rated for AC-3 motor switching at 37 kW at 500 V and 18.6 kW at 690 V — these are the numbers that govern motor starting and running duty. For a 37 kW motor at 500 V, this contactor handles the inrush and breaking current without excessive contact wear. At 690 V the power drops to 18.6 kW because the same current limit applies at higher voltage. The main current circuit uses screw-type terminals, accepting solid conductors 2x (0.5...1.5 mm²), 2x (0.75...2.5 mm²), max. 2x (0.75...4 mm²), and stranded conductors 2x (10...50 mm²). The larger stranded range (up to 50 mm²) handles the motor feeder; the smaller solid range suits control wiring for auxiliary contacts. Auxiliary contact ratings: 10 A at 24 V, 6 A at 230 V, 3 A at 400 V — these are the make/break capacities for the built-in auxiliary contacts. Use them for PLC inputs, contactor feedback, or interlocking. Maximum switching rates: 1,000 1/h at AC-1 and AC-3, 400 1/h at AC-2, 300 1/h at AC-4. IP20 on the front with cover or box terminal; IP00 at the terminal itself. The front IP20 is adequate for finger-safe installation inside a locked panel; the open terminal area requires the panel door to be closed during operation. Operating temperature -25...+60 °C, storage -55...+80 °C. Switching times: arcing time 10...15 ms, total make/break time at AC 10...19 ms. These are fast enough for most motor control sequences; for synchronised switching or soft-starter bypass, the 10 ms spread matters for timing coordination.
